Can You Buy a Home While Deployed?
Yes — VA loans support deployed borrowers through POA, e-close, and spouse-first occupancy. Here's how.
The short answer
Yes. Deployed active-duty service members close VA loans every day. It requires more paperwork discipline up front, but the process is well-established.
The two enablers are the specific-transaction POA and spouse-first occupancy.
Spouse-first occupancy
The VA treats spouse occupancy as satisfying the borrower's occupancy requirement. Your spouse moves in, you satisfy the rule.
This is the most common deployed-purchase path.
The paperwork stack
Orders, LES, POA (recorded in the closing county), and a signed intent-to-occupy statement. Everything else is standard.
Deployment files depend on complete documentation and a valid power of attorney; actual timelines vary by lender and file.
